Syriac Union Party in Lebanon holds election rally in support of Lebanese Forces Party-Popular Bloc combination in Zahle

ZAHLE, Lebanon – Secretary General of the Syriac Union Party in Lebanon Michel Mallo yesterday received Strong Republic Bloc MP Elias Stephan, a delegation from the Lebanese Forces Party’s Zahle electoral coordination committee, led by Alan Mounayer, as well as Popular Bloc candidate for mayor of Zahle Salim Ghazali.

The Universal Syriac Union Party (USUP) reaffirmed its electoral coalition and full support for the Lebanese Forces Party and also the Popular Bloc, led by Salim Ghazali. USUP has mobilized its party base in support of the Lebanese Forces Party. The Popular Bloc has its headquarters in Zahle.

The joint election meeting was held in preparation for the municipal elections next month. Participants were informed about the program and had the opportunity to ask questions about public services in their district. Attendees stressed the need to develop the region and address the existing problems with regards to public services that fall under the jurisdiction of Zahle municipality and district. The elections concern all of Zahle district, where approximately 175,000 voters are eligible to vote.

The Lebanese Ministry of the Interior and Municipalities has announced that the municipal elections will be held throughout Lebanon for four weeks during May. They will take place on the 4th in Mount Lebanon, on the 11th in North Lebanon and Akkar, on the 18th in Beirut, the Bekaa, Baalbek and Hermione, and on the 25th in South Lebanon and Nabatieh.
